> @@ -165,11 +165,11 @@ get_present_cpus()
>  
>  # get_present_cpus_num()
>  #
> -#  Prints the number of present CPUs
> +#  Gets the number of present CPUs
>  #
>  get_present_cpus_num()
>  {
> -    return $(get_present_cpus | wc -w)
> +     PRESENT_CPUS_NUM=`get_present_cpus | wc -w`
>  }

Passing the value by global variable is ugly. Why don't we echo the
value here as:

echo $(get_present_cpus |wc -w), or even just call 'get_presnt_cpus |wc -w'

and do:

if [ $(get_present_cpus_num) -lt 2 ]; then
...
fi

in the testcases?
